Getting China to Support a Denuclearized North Korea

In the upcoming August 27-29 "six-party" talks in Beijing, theUnited States must not risk turning the clock back to August 1994,when the Chinese persuaded the Clinton Administration to give NorthKorea billions in aid without first requiring Pyongyang to forswearits nuclear ambitions. To avoid repeating past mistakes, U.S.negotiators must have a clear-eyed view of China's role in theNorth Korean nuclear issue.
